It will be accessible to PhD-level students (and exceptional masters students) and it will take a modern view of the subject, with emphasis on the relation between these topics and the roles of symmetries, including non-invertible symmetries. For this reason, we believe that it may be of interest also to post-doctoral researchers who want to enter this field. Titles and lecturers:? - Lattice models and their continuum limit - Sascha Gehrmann (U Oxford) - Two-dimensional Conformal Field Theory - Enrico Marchetto (DESY) - Non-invertible symmetries - Lea Bottini (IHES) - S-matrix bootstrap - Davide Polvara (U Hamburg) - Thermodynamic Bethe Ansatz - Alessio Miscioscia (U Stony Brook) As in the tradition of this school series, we will emphasise the links between different lecture courses, and provide the students with high-quality lecture notes. Applications will open in the new year, and there will be an opportunity to request financial support from the COST Action.
